java
ccxcccx
这个作者很懒,什么都没留下…
展开
-
JAVA锁的思维导图
原创 2020-01-18 11:29:29 · 657 阅读 · 0 评论 -
javax.imageio.IIOException: Unsupported Image Type异常,解决方法
javax.imageio.IIOException: Unsupported Image Type异常可以采用如下方案:public class ImagesUtils { public static byte[] compressImage(File file, int ppi) { byte[] smallImage = null; try { BufferedImage...原创 2020-01-09 14:45:53 · 2784 阅读 · 0 评论 -
全面解析Redis、JVM
一、Redis1.Redis 是什么?都有哪些使用场景?Redis 是一个使用 C 语言开发的高速缓存数据库。Redis 使用场景: 记录帖子点赞数、点击数、评论数; 缓存近期热帖; 缓存文章详情信息; 记录用户会话信息。 2. Redis 有哪些功能? 数据缓存功能 分布式锁的功能 支持数据持久化 ...原创 2019-11-15 14:35:03 · 1123 阅读 · 0 评论 -
归并排序Java版
public class MergeSort { public static void merge(int[] list, int low, int mid, int high) { System.out.println(low+","+mid+","+high); int i = low; int j = mid + 1; ...原创 2019-11-14 15:19:14 · 96 阅读 · 0 评论 -
log4j只记录指定类的日志到文件中
#### 设置###debuglog4j.appender.encoding = UTF-8log4j.rootLogger=debug,info,stdout,warn,errorlog4j.appender.stdout=org.apache.log4j.ConsoleAppenderlog4j.appender.stdout.Target=System.outlog4j.app...原创 2019-09-12 15:31:06 · 631 阅读 · 0 评论 -
Netty增加自定义解码器解决粘包分包问题
netty框架自带的粘包分包解码器FixedLengthFrameDecoder (固定长度解码器)DelimiterBasedFrameDecoder(分隔符解码器)LineBasedFrameDecoder("\r\n"换行符解码器)以上这些可以解决一般情况下的问题一些特殊规则下,我们需要自定义解码器例如:aa 0a 00 00 00 02 b2 00 00 00 00 00 be...原创 2019-07-22 16:41:57 · 929 阅读 · 0 评论 -
Gson转换与JSONObject区别
package demo1;import net.sf.json.JSONObject;import com.google.gson.Gson;public class Demo {private int a;private String b;private String c;public int getA() {return a;}public void setA(int ...原创 2017-03-25 15:38:19 · 2721 阅读 · 1 评论